The 'Domaine de la Sablière' (naturist campsite) faces fully south and enjoys an exceptional climate. This 62-hectare natural park overlooking the gorges at Cèze and is an ideal location to enjoy Nature full of sun, smells and laziness. Theme-based evening entertainment, French musette dancing, cabaret, dancing for all tastes, classical music, puppet shows, magicians, karaoke, circus, star-gazing, board game tournaments, on the 14th July and 15th August costume balls (open theme) and audiovisual projections. Also, in July and August: Tai-Chi, keep-fit sports, ‘soft’ gym, Aqua gym, water games, beginners’ archery, family walks, sports meetings (volleyball, tennis, petanque, ping-pong and badminton) fishing in the Cèze (with fishing permit). You can also do (in July and August): Children’s and adults manual workshops, pottery, ceramics, painting on silk for over 14 year olds, bookbinding workshops, mosaic, Mini-club (from 4 years old) and Junior and Teenager clubs. From the Domain you have a splendid view over the Gorges of the Cèze and it offers you a 180° wooded horizons without any civilization trail ! Nothing less than sunny green hills with the Cevennes at the background In the surrounding, you can visit Nîmes, this sun-baked town, is a soft-spoken friendly host, having kept its Mediterranean lifestyle fully intact. The famous Pont du Gard, Uzes, the Ceze Valley and the lovely and traditional markets… By road : on the A7 motorway, take the Bollène exit, head for Pont St-Esprit, and then take the 901 Départementale road towards Barjac, 5 Km before getting to Barjac, take the CD266 St-Privat de Champclos and follow the signs to the Sablière. By train : Avignon railway station then change at the bus station for Barjac (contact : 04.90.82.07.35) By plane : Airports at Nîmes (90 Km) or Marseille (150 Km)
